Comparative analysis of antibodies to SARS-CoV-2 between asymptomatic and convalescent patients

Abstract: Highlights 60,000 asymptomatic individuals were assessed for SARS-CoV-2 antibody responses Increased Spike IgG correlates with antibody diversity and ACE2 binding inhibition COVID-19 patients had lower antibody responses compared with high asymptomatic responders Individuals can mount diverse immune responses to COVID-19 without symptoms

“…The RBD of the S-protein mediates the entry into human cells by binding the angiotensin-converting enzyme 2 (ACE-2) receptor ( Di Nardo et al, 2021 ). Positive correlation between anti-RBD immunoglobulin G (IgG) antibody levels and the inhibition of ACE2 binding and neutralizing antibodies has been described ( Ni et al, 2020 , Suhandynata et al, 2021 , Dwyer et al, 2021 ). It is suggested that the determination of anti-RBD IgG antibodies could be a good marker of neutralizing activity ( Dwyer et al, 2021 , Han et al, 2021 , Beaudoin-Bussières et al, 2020 ).…”
